Insipid
7 lettersadjectivemoderateUpdated June 2026
Definition
Lacking flavour, interest, or any stimulating quality, dull and bland.
“The soup was insipid and needed a good deal of seasoning.”
Pronunciation
IPA
/ɪnˈsɪp.ɪd/
Syllables
in·sip·id
